General maintenance
Besides the above hazard, dirt, or moisture in the terminals
can distort readings. The steps for cleaning are as follows:
1 Turn the meter off and remove the test leads.
2 Turn the meter over and shake out any dirt that may
have accumulated in the terminals.
3 Wipe the case with a damp cloth and a mild detergent —
do not use abrasives or solvents. Wipe the contacts in
each terminal with a clean swab dipped in alcohol.
Battery replacement
The meter is powered by a 9 V Ni- MH rechargeable battery,
7.2 V nominal voltage. Use only the specified type (refer to
Figure 5- 1). To ensure that the correct battery type is used,
replace the battery immediately when the low battery sign
flashes. If your meter has the rechargeable battery type,
refer to the section “Charging the battery” on page 103.
